That’s the most amazing thing I’ve seen these last two days, Macon press has killed teams. We played them multiple times this year and their press wasn’t a factor. They started out pressing the first 2,3 or 4 possessions and then pulled it off cause it wasn’t turning us over. Can’t throw long or soft, high passes against it. Ball fake high and split it and go. Got to be able to beat it off the dribble and look opposite over the top. Not hard but seems to be Rubik’s cube for their opponents the last 2 days. Macon should be careful. Third game in 3 days playing 5 kids. They press very much and may gas a couple of their own out. Grainger looks to be able to play tough man D, which you have to against Macon, and they all look very well conditioned.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
